South Wales, Sept. 11 -- United Kingdom Intellectual Property Office (UKIPO) has registered trademark "Kaiko Systems" on June 22. The details about the trademark application no. UK00004405661 published in the journal no. 2026/037 (Sept. 11).
With BRIMONDO UK LTD as representative, UniSea AS filed the trademark application for the below mentioned good(s)/service(s).
